Rodents usually eat their offspring as a result of several things(and it is kinda common). If the mother gets nervous or feels threatened they may eat their children as a way of protecting themselves. Also, If food and water supplies are too low the mother may reduce the size of her litter by eating some of the offspring so that the food and water supplies will be adequate. To reduce the chances of this happening, do not disturb the babies until aleast a week has passed and keep more water and food available than usual.
